I was really wondering , why people help to develop Bitcoin ? is it their main job ? If it's the case then how they are getting paid and from who exactly ?
I assume that creators of Lightweight wallets gets only donations and money of advertising for Trezor or other hardwallets as-well .

I remember Mike Hearn saying that he has left his previous job to work full-time into Bitcoin development so I guess they receive royalties or direct payment from the Foundation. Also if you can get sponsors you can pretty much get by just from that.
